Hostile Workplace, A Breaking the Rules Novel Kindle Edition
Sam Stanton knows these simple facts:
~ He is a great catch--successful, smart, gorgeous...but the wrong woman caught him.
~ He has the perfect girl who is madly in love with him.
~ He wasted six years of his life by playing it safe.
~ He is damn good at his job and intends to keep climbing the ladder.
~ He can't get her off his mind or out of his heart--no matter how hard he tries.
But, what he doesn't know is just as important:
~ Will he ever really move on and forget how badly she broke his heart?
~ Should he settle for a sure thing, even knowing it's the wrong thing?
~ Can he give up his career for a chance at happiness?
~ Does he correct one mistake with another?
~ What would he do if she were to return?
Confused yet? Welcome to Sam Stanton's life.
Hostile Workplace is book 2 in the Breaking the Rules Series and meant for a mature reading audience.

About the author

A USA Today bestselling, award-winning author, A. M. Madden is also a Jersey girl whose addiction to romance started at twelve after reading Judy Blume’s Forever.
As a self-proclaimed hopeless romantic, she truly believes that true love knows no bounds.
In her books, she aspires to write fun, sexy, love stories that will stay with you long after you turn the last page. She creates realistic characters and believes there’s no better compliment than when readers feel they know the characters personally.
When not writing, she’s busy being a wife to her soul mate, and a mother to two boys who she believes are the most handsome men on earth. She loves to cook, hates to bake, and dreams about living at the beach someday.

I’ve been sat staring at my laptop for the past hour trying to figure out where to start with my review. All I can come up with is I LOVE THIS BOOK AND I LOVE SAM STANTON.
Sam is brilliant at his job and is right where he wants to be in all aspects of his life – or so he pretends to be. Six years ago the love of his life left him and as much as he thinks he is over her, he clearly isn’t. He’s in a safe relationship and spends most of his time in the office being an ass to his work colleagues but getting the job done. That is until Lydia, the one who shattered his heart, walks into his office.
As their worlds collide, can the two of them reconcile their differences and get along for the sake of their jobs or is there just too much hostility between them to work in the same city, let alone the same company.
This book can be read as a standalone and does feature slightly Sam’s younger sister Rebecca who we met in Love on the Horizon. I can’t say too much about the book without giving away spoilers. What I can say is that Ann Marie knows how to write complex and intriguing characters who you will both fall in love with and dislike with a passion. The alternative POV’s help to weave the story of 2 people who might be perfect for each but just don’t realise it. There is everything you need in this book for a 5 star read and this just cements her place as an author who I will always one click without any hesitation.
